#265632 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#265632 is composed of 14.9% red, 33.7%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.9%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 135 degrees, a saturation of 38.7% and a lightness of 24.3%. #265632 color hex could be obtained by blending #4cac64 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#265632 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#265632 has RGB values of R:38, G:86,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 2512434.

Shades and Tints of #265632
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020403 is the darkest color, while #f6fb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#265632
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e3e3e is the less saturated color, while #057721 is the most saturated one.
